Answer:
2 hours
Step-by-step explanation:
Let's denote the amount of time we need to find out, t.
=> 600 + 50t < 500 + 100t
or 600 - 500 < 100t - 50t
or 100 < 50t
or 100/50 < t
or t > 2
=> After 2 hours, company B will be cheaper option than company A
